Ticket #2093 — Evacuation-chair store, Stairwell D, Orlingbrook Tower. Quarterly inspection due. Night shift: check both chairs for brake function, strap wear, and inflated wheels. Log results on the sheet inside the door. Report any defects to facilities before 6am handover. Store must be relocked after inspection — do not prop the door. Replacement straps are in the cabinet, second shelf. The store door has its own keypad, separate from the stairwell locks, so use the code below.

staff pass of kawip-hawef = bdg-QLP-2

// Broker upgrade notes for plugin authors:
// Quillbus 4.x replaces the legacy 3.x wire protocol. Plugins must
// construct the client with explicit protocol negotiation enabled,
// or connections to the Larkfield cluster will be silently downgraded
// and dropped after 30s. Topic names are unchanged. For local testing
// against the sandbox broker, authenticate with the key below.

API key for bafof-bagaf: qvz2-qi

Minutes — Management Meeting

Prepared for the incoming director. Topic: possible acquisition of Greyfen Analytics. Due diligence 70% complete. Valuation gap remains; Greyfen seeks a premium. Integration risks flagged by Ops. Decision deferred to next month. Talla Nyberg leads negotiations. Our walk-away position is stated below.

board note of fawig-kagup: Only 48 of the 435 pilot accounts renewed Rusion, so a churn review is set for September 12. Fenwynox Logistics is in early talks to buy Sorielek Systems for about $117.8 million.